How To Write Resume For Investment Advisor

  • Highlight your expertise in investment management, portfolio construction, and risk assessment.
  • Showcase your ability to build strong client relationships and provide personalized financial advice.
  •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ics, such as portfolio returns or client satisfaction ratings
  • Emphasize your commitment to continuing education and professional development in the financial industry

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Investment Advisor Resume

Here are a few key responsibilities/highlights that you can consider to include in your experience section while creating a Investment Advisor resume that can significantly enhance your resume’s impact.
  • Advise high-net-worth clients on investment strategies, asset allocation, and financial planning
  • Manage investment portfolios, ensuring compliance with investment objectives and risk tolerance
  • Conduct thorough market research and analysis to identify undervalued assets and investment opportunities
  • Provide comprehensive financial advisory services, including tax planning, estate planning, and risk management
  • Collaborate with lawyers and accountants to ensure adherence to legal and regulatory requirements
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with clients, building trust and loyalty

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Investment Advisor

  • What is the role of an Investment Advisor?

    Investment Advisors provide personalized financial advice and investment management services to individuals, families, and institutions. They analyze clients’ financial goals, risk tolerance, and time horizon to develop and implement customized investment strategies.

  • What qualifications are required to become an Investment Advisor?

    Investment Advisors typically hold a bachelor’s or master’s degree in finance, economics, or a related field. They must also pass the Series 65 exam administered by the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A)

  • What are the key responsibilities of an Investment Advisor?

    Investment Advisors are responsible for conducting market research, analyzing investment opportunities, developing and implementing investment strategies, and providing ongoing portfolio management and financial advice to their clients.

  • How much do Investment Advisors earn?

    The salary of an Investment Advisor can vary depending on their experience, qualifications, and the size of their firm.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ual salary for Financial Advisors was \$94,180 in May 2022.

  • What is the job outlook for Investment Advisors?

    The job outlook for Investment Advisors is expected to grow faster than average in the coming years. This is due to the increasing demand for financial advice and investment management services from individuals and families.
